41 Vying for Cherokee Teacher of the Year

The Cherokee County School District announced the nominees this week.

 

Forty-one teachers are in the running for 2013 Cherokee County School District Teacher of the Year honors.

One winner will be selected in the fall, district spokeswoman Barbara Jacoby said.

Here are the nominees from each Cherokee County school:
